Transaction 41e2166c5aff875f64712f849b2ea7eae73b22424d0878732c31e44e12760522

2 Input
2 Outputs
  • 41e2166c5aff875f64712f849b2ea7eae73b22424d0878732c31e44e12760522:0
  • value  126203183
    address  16X8MiLGt1mr593nYquxMYkCCqcy1MiHNS
  • 41e2166c5aff875f64712f849b2ea7eae73b22424d0878732c31e44e12760522:1
  • value  196112500
    address  13fThe4rheHBhuTxBB6YryxUhK4yVptfvo